The Assets feature within Maintenance module is used to search and modify the details of the individual Serial Items (Assets) like Asset's home site, pricing details, purchase details etc., You can also view more details of the asset like what was the last order that the asset was used, any damages in asset, and more.

Defining Search condition

The search condition selected determines how the values entered are used to search the asset records.. The following table describes about the search condition and its results.

Table 1.1: Defining Search condition field details

Field

Description

Any Part of Field

Returns the records that match the value given to any part of the selected field type

Start of Field          

Returns the records that match with the value given in the beginning of the field type

Whole Field

Searches the entire field for matching criteria. This displays the record, which exactly matches with the given search criteria. So while using this option, information given should be correct

Equal

Returns the records that are equal to the value given in the search field

Not Equal

Returns the records that are not equal to the value given in the search field

Greater

Returns the records that are greater than the value given in the search field

Greater or Equal

Returns the records that are greater than or equal to the value given in the search field

Less or Equal

Returns the records that are less than or equal to the value given in the search field

Between

Returns the records that are between the values in the first and second search fields

Advance Searching

The Advanced button on the Asset Search window opens the Advanced Search window. It allows you to widen or narrow a search based on criteria that you input.

  1. Click the Advance button in the search order window to display Advance Search dialog.

  2. Select the column name by which the asset has to be searched.

  3. Click the condition drop-down menu to select search condition.  

  4. Select the search result sort order dropdown menu.

  5. Click Search icon.

  6. The search results will be displayed in the Asset search window based on the search condition.

You can also add multiple conditions for search by clicking the Add icon.

Advance search - search conditions

If multiple conditions are used for searching Asset, search condition can be applied to perform the search based on all conditions or any of the conditions defined.

  • Match all of the following- Displays the assets that match all the conditions defined.

  • Match any of the following- Displays the assets that match any of the conditions defined.

When you try to change the Product ID for a serial asset, the system blocks the change in some cases. Also, the system explains why change is blocked.

The system checks the asset’s usage in orders, warehouse activity, and unsaved transactions. It restricts the change if the asset status is not IN or if the asset is used in an open or unsaved order. If another user is working on the order, the system identifies them and tells you to try again after the order is closed.

Common Reasons Product ID Change Is Blocked

R2 would prevent Product ID change in the following situations:

  • Asset is not in IN status - When the Asset’s status is anything other then IN, system will stop you from changing it’s Product ID and displays a message as “Asset status is not IN”.

  • Asset is Locked to Kit - When an Asset is locked to a Serial Kit Asset, system will stop you from changing it’s Product ID and displays a message as “Asset locked to Kit”.

  • Physical Inventory Count in progress - When there a Physical Inventory counting is progress for the selected Asset’s product, system will not proceed further and shows the message as “Physical Inventory Count in progress”.

  • Asset is still being used on one or more orders - This condition occurs when Asset is added by Asset ID/Serial ID and status is Reserved / Not Available on the order. R2 lists the impacting order numbers so that you can identify where the asset is currently assigned.

  • Warehouse processing is in progress - This condition occurs when the asset status is IN and was used on any of the orders and the respective orders' warehouse task(s) is kept open by some one. R2 indicates the user holding the order and advises you to contact them and retry once the order is closed.

image-20260102-070345.png

  • Asset is added to an order that has not been saved - If the asset was entered using the Serial/Asset ID on an Order but the order has not yet been saved, R2 blocks the change until the order is saved or the asset is removed from that order.
    Note: If the asset was entered on a new order and has not yet been saved, R2 blocks the change and shows the message indicating the user names only not the order number since it would not have been assigned a number yet.

When you receive a restriction message:

  1. Review the order numbers shown in the message.

  2. If an “In Use By” user is listed, contact the user and ask them to close the order or complete warehouse processing.

If the message indicates the order is not saved, ensure the order is saved or remove the asset from the open transaction.

  1. Retry the Product ID update after the related order activity is completed. 

When you import assets of another product through Item Edit > Import Assets feature, the system applies the same restriction rules and displays similar messages for consistent guidance. Click here to know more on Import Assets feature.
